CBS Wins Monday in Adults 18-49 and Adults 25-54 for the Second Consecutive Week
CBS spins the numbers for Monday, March 31.

[via press release from CBS]

CBS WINS MONDAY IN ADULTS 18-49 AND ADULTS 25-54 FOR THE SECOND CONSECUTIVE WEEK

The Season Finale of "The New Adventures of Old Christine" Posts Season Highs in Viewers and Key Demographics

"Two and a Half Men" Is Monday's Number One Program in Adults 18-49

"CSI: Miami" Retains 98% of Last Week's First-Run Return Delivery in Adults 18-49 and 97% in Viewers

CBS placed first on Monday in adults 18-49 and adults 25-54 for the second consecutive week as THE NEW ADVENTURES OF OLD CHRISTINE won its time period in all key measures with season high ratings and TWO AND A HALF MEN was the night's Number One program in adults 18-49, according to preliminary live plus same day ratings for March 31.

BIG BANG THEORY finished second in households (5.5/09), viewers (8.68m), adults 25-54 (3.8/10) and adults 18-49 (3.1/09). Compared to last week's broadcast, BIG BANG THEORY was up +6% in households (from 5.2/08) and added +150,000 viewers (from 8.53m, +2%).

HOW I MET YOUR MOTHER was second in households (5.9/09), viewers (9.67m), adults 25-54 (4.6/11) and adults 18-49 (4.0/11). This was the second largest audience of the season, trailing only last week's episode which featured a guest appearance by Britney Spears.

At 9:00 PM, TWO AND A HALF MEN was second in households (8.8/13), viewers (14.43m), adults 25-54 (6.6/15) and adults 18-49 (5.3/13, -0.1 behind ABC). Compared to last week, TWO AND A HALF MEN was up +2% in both households (from 8.6/13) and adults 18-49 (from 5.2/13), even in adults 25-54 while adding +190,000 viewers (from 14.24m, +1%). TWO AND A HALF MEN is the night's Number One program in adults18-49.

The season finale of THE NEW ADVENTURES OF OLD CHRISTINE was first in households (8.0/12), adults 25-54 (5.6/13), adults 18-49 (4.4/11) and a close second in viewers (12.41m, -0.02m behind NBC). THE NEW ADVENTURES OF OLD CHRISTINE was up +29% in households (from 6.2/09), +17% in adults 25-54 (from 4.8/11), +16% in adults 18-49 (from 3.8/09) and added +2.64m viewers (from 9.77m, +27%) compared to last week.

THE NEW ADVENTURES OF OLD CHRISTINE posted season highs in households, viewers, adults 25-54 and adults 18-49.

At 10:00 PM, CSI: MIAMI was first in households (10.0/16), viewers (15.53m), adults 25-54 (6.0/14) and adults 18-49 (4.8/12). Compared to the program's first-run return last week, CSI: MIAMI was retained 98% of its adults 18-49 delivery, 97% of its households and viewers deliveries and 95% of its adults 25-54 performance.

For the night, CBS was first in adults 25-54 (5.4/13), adults 18-49 (4.4/11) - both for the second consecutive week - and second in households (8.0/12) and viewers (12.71m).
